Governance

At the national level, 4-H Canada (previously known as the Canadian 4-H Council) was created in 1933 to act on behalf of the 4-H movement in Canada. Operationally, 4-H Canada staff handles the planning, implementation and management of national programs, scholarships and more.

About the 4-H Canada Board of Directors

The 4-H Canada Board of Directors is a national volunteer board that governs 4-H Canada, oversees and sets 4-H Canada’s overarching strategic direction and is accountable to its members.

The board is elected by the Members of 4-H Canada - individuals over 18 years of age and organizations dedicated to the advancement of the 4-H movement in Canada.
